Descripción
Sumario:The Rh(iii)-catalyzed synthesis of spiroquinoxalinone derivatives from 3-arylquinoxalin-2(1H)-ones and alkynes via a C–H functionalization/[3 + 2] annulation sequence has been developed. This method, featuring low catalyst loading, was amenable to Gram scale synthesis and tolerated a variety of functional groups and substitution patterns on the aryl rings, providing the target products in good to excellent yields.
